The World's Columbian Exposition — also known as The Chicago World's Fair —
was a World's Fair held in Chicago in 1893 to celebrate the 400th anniversary of
Christopher Columbus's arrival in the New World. Chicago bested New York City,
Washington, D.C. and St. Louis, Missouri, for the honor of hosting the fair. The
fair had a profound effect on architecture, the arts, Chicago's self-image, and
American industrial optimism. The Chicago Columbian Exposition was, in large part,
designed by Daniel Burnham and Frederick Law Olmsted. It was the prototype of what
Burnham and his colleagues thought a city should be.
The exposition covered more than 600 acres, featuring nearly 200 new
buildings of classical architecture, canals and lagoons, and people and cultures
from around the world. Over 27 million people (equivalent to about half the U.S.
population) attended the exposition during its six-month run. Its scale and
grandeur far exceeded the other world fairs, and it became a symbol of the
emerging American Exceptionalism, much in the same way that the Great Exhibition
became a symbol of the Victorian era United Kingdom.
